Optimally tuned for listening to electronic musical instruments, HPH-150 headphones offer excellent tonal projection, with a crisp, clear sound that you won’t tire of even after prolonged use, and superb sound separation ensuring that each and every sonic detail is reproduced accurately.
Open-air headphones with a neutral tone palette for faithful reproduction of digital musical instrument sounds
Featuring small, soft, light-weight velour ear pads and a swivel mechanism, which allows 90 degree turns to properly fit your ear angle
Compact, fashionable design available in black or white to match your instrument
Gold plated stereo plug and 2-meter cable for easy, convenient connection
Comfortable listening for extended periods
